Which attribute of a cookie do you set to create a persistent cookie?

Computers and Technology
1 answer:
hammer [34]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

max_age

Explanation:

A HTTP Cookie represents a piece of data which is stored by a website on the web-browser. It can contain information relevant to the , for example, username, layout preference etc. Normally, a cookie gets deleted when the browser is closed. However,a persistent cookie remains stored across multiple browser sessions.Cookie can be made persistent by setting its max_age attribute. max_age represents the number of seconds after which the cookie will deleted from the browser.

Is it possible for the front and rear references in a circular array implementation to be equal?
azamat

Answer:

Yes it is possible for the following cases:-

  1. When the queue is full.
  2. When the queue is empty.

Explanation:

When the queue is full the the front and the rear references in the circular array implementation are equal because after inserting an element in the queue we increase the rear pointer.So when inserting the last element the rear pointer will be increased and it will become equal to front pointer.

When the queue is empty the front and rear pointer are equal.We remove an element from queue by deleting the element at front pointer decreasing the front pointer when there is only one element and we are deleting that element front and rear pointer will become equal after deleting that element.

The general case in a recursive function is the case for which the solution is obtained directly.
Reika [66]

Answer: False.

Explanation:

The general case of recursive function is when the solution is obtained recursively by simplification at each step.

However, it is the base case in a recursive function when the solution is obtained directly.

The general case must be reducible to base to arrive at a solution else the recursion would be a infinite recursion.
